Adjusting PS5 Sound Settings for an Enhanced Experience
Fine-tuning audio settings is a critical step in enhancing your sound experience with the PS5. After you have your headphones connected, explore the PS5's audio options thoroughly. This ensures they perform at their best, whether for music, gaming, or movies.
Utilizing 3D Audio for Immersive Gaming
One of the most innovative features of the PS5 is its 3D audio capability, which plays a significant role in how you experience sound during gameplay. To use this feature, ensure you are utilizing compatible headphones.
Activate it in the Sound settings by selecting 3D Audio Profile. Customize this profile to your preference, and listen for positional audio clarity, which can give you a significant advantage during gameplay.
Balancing Game and Chat Audio
To reach a well-balanced sound environment, adjusting the game and chat audio levels can enhance your overall experience. Within audio settings, you can typically find options for balancing these elements. This is particularly important for multiplayer games where communication is key.

Troubleshooting PS5 Headphone Connection Issues
Encountering issues when trying to connect headphones to PS5 can be frustrating. However, many problems can often be resolved with a few troubleshooting steps. Knowing the common pitfalls can help you avoid audio headaches in the future.
Common Headphone Connection Problems
Occasionally, users face issues such as headphones not being detected, dynamic audio not working, or poor sound quality. Before exploring complex solutions, check that the headphones are charged (for wireless variants) and safely plugged in (for wired options).
Audio Troubleshooting Steps for PS5
- Reconnect your headphones by unplugging and plugging them back in or re-pairing them.
- Restart your PS5 system to reset the audio configurations.
- Check your PS5 audio output settings to confirm they are correct.
